Us Visas For Indian Citizens - The Facts Table of ContentsFascination About Us Visas For Indian CitizensThe 20-Second Trick For Us Visas For Indian CitizensGetting My Us Visas For Indian Citizens To WorkThe 9-Minute Rule for Us Visas For Indian CitizensRumored Buzz on Us Visas For Indian CitizensKEEP IN MIND: https://andynokdv.buyoutblog.com/36892597/not-known-facts-about-us-visas-for-indian-citizens